Campbell remains a Pirate
17 May 2007 - 09:56:15
Bristol Rovers have retained the services of Stuart Campbell after agreeing a new two-year contract with the midfielder.
The former Leicester City and Grimsby Town midfielder has made over 130 appearances for the Pirates since arriving at the Memorial Stadium on a free transfer three years ago.
"I'm delighted to agree a new two-year deal," he told the club's official website.
"There's been a degree of speculation over one or two players but I think I've made my position quite clear all along - and that is that I want to stay at Bristol Rovers.
"I've committed myself to two more years because I really believe this club is going places and I want to be a part of that."
